添加linux菜单有2种途径
1.采用linux菜单编辑器编辑。
选择System->Perferences->Main Menu或在Terminal下输入alacarte进入编辑器。不过用这种方式新建的菜单只对当前用户有效,而且无法删除菜单即使有root权限。删除的效果其实只是隐藏。
如果添加一个菜单(以在Applictions菜单下添加子菜单为例),将在/root/.local/share/applications下生成alacarte-made-x.desktop之类的文件,在/root/.config/menus下的applications.menu文件里增加如下数据:
<Include>
<Filename>alacarte-made-x.desktop</Filename>
</Include>
(如果第一次修改将在/root/.config下生成menus目录,在/root/.local下生成share目录)
2.手动添加.desktop文件将编辑好的.desktop文件放到/usr/share/applications目录下。
这种菜单对所有用户有效,菜单信息在/etc/xdg/menus目录下。
在ubuntu10.04系统中,在/usr/share/applications目录下有一个cache文件,命名为desktop.语言简码.cache,以desktop.en_US.utf8.cache为例,该文件缓存了菜单信息。如果当前系统语言为en_US.utf8(在Terminal中输入echo $LANG可查看当前系统语言简码),则当系统重启后,添加的菜单会消失,原因是cache文件里面没有该菜单对应得信息。如果当前系统语言不是en_US.utf8,则不会有此问题。所以在ubuntu10.04系统中,手动添加一个菜单项除了编辑.desktop文件外,还需要修改/usr/share/applications/desktop.语言简码.cache,在中间添加一段信息,如:
[new menu]
Name=menu name
Exec=command
Categories=Application;Network;
......
分享到:
相关推荐
文本编辑器Vi 简介 Vi是一个功能强大的全屏幕文本编辑器,是UNIX ...pVi没有菜单,只有命令。 注意:Vi命令并不锁住所编辑的文件,因此多个用户可能同时编辑一个文件,那么最后保存的文件版本将被保留。
在进行Linux服务器管理里,使用编辑软件进行脚本编辑是必不可少的。可是对于很多习惯菜单、鼠标操作的管理者来说,实在是不习惯,也记不住那么多的命令。现在给你提供一个手册和学习案例。你可以在需要时查一查,在...
vim编辑器是linux平台使用最广的编辑器了,功能强大,没有菜单只有命令。
grubmenu是grubutil工程中的新增工具,利用它可以修改grldr/grub.exe/stage2中的内置菜单。 用法: grubmenu info grldr 显示grldr的内置菜单相关的信息 grubmenu print grldr 打印grldr中的内置菜单 grubmenu ...
vi或vim是Linux最基本的文本编辑工具,vi或vim虽然没有图形界面编辑器那样点鼠标的简单操作,但vi编辑器在系统管理、服务器管理字符界面中,永远不是图形界面的编辑器能比的。vi常用命令 vi常用命令 (注意:vi是...
EasyBCD是一款免费软件,EasyBCD能够极好地支持多种操作系统与Windows 7、Vista结合的多重启动,包括Linux、 Mac OS X、 BSD等,当然也包括微软自家的Windows 2000/XP。任何在安装Windows7前其能够正常启动的系统,...
vi(visual interface)是Linux和UNIX中功能最为强大的全屏幕文本编辑器。不是一个排版程序。 vim没有菜单,只有命令,且命令繁多。只要在命令行上键入vim就可进入vim的编辑环境。 步骤1:启动vim编辑器 vim 文件名...
Linux操作系统软件包不仅包括完整的Linux操作系统,而且还包括了文本编辑器、高级语言编译器等应用软件。它还包括带有多个窗口管理器的X-Windows图形用户界面,如同我们使用Windows NT一样,允许我们使用窗口、图标...
Sublime Text 是一个跨平台的编辑器,同时支持 Windows、Linux、Mac OS X 等操作系统。它有许多亮点,诸如:轻量级,强大的api和包生态,性能高,极致体验等等,后面的章节我们将一一叙述。 这里主要讲解的是...
Sublime Text是一款流行的代码编辑器。Sublime Text 具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。...Sublime Text 是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。
vim的常用操作,vim没有菜单,只有命令 插入模式 定位命令 4. 删除命令 5. 复制和剪切 6. 替代和取消 7.搜索与替换 6. 保存与退出 7. 导入命令执行结果. ‘:r ! 命令’ 导入文件。 ‘:r 文件’ 导入该文件到...
1 使用系统编辑器打开在eclipse 中选中的文件或目录(linux 上有些编辑器可以对目录进行编辑,如emacs), 优点是,当系统编辑器关闭时,eclipse会刷新项目所有文件,并重新编译项目。 如果没关闭编辑器,则每隔30s...
在Windows下有TC, BC, VC等编译器,它们极大地方便了程序的编辑编译等,在Windows下你只需要看明白菜单就可以了。Linux下C++编程和在Windows下的没有什么两样,它同样需要编译、链接、调度、运行等步骤,只不过执行...
被资料,主要是基于linux中的使用,它主要是在vi编辑器中,编写带菜单的程序,这样就能方便程序的调用和使用
5.3.6 编辑KDE面板菜单 71 5.3.7 使用kfm文件管理器 71 5.4 使用KDE Control Center配置KDE 71 5.4.1 使用显示管理器选项 72 5.4.2 更改桌面墙纸 73 5.4.3 更改屏幕保护程序 74 5.4.4 安装系统声音 75 5.4.5 更改...
可以用任意一个文本编辑器打开passwd文件,该文件里包含用冒号分隔开的字段组成的记录,如下所示: root:x:0:0:root:/root:/bin/bash zxj:x:500:500:zxj303:/home/zxj:/bin/bash . . . 在主Shell脚本...
文本编辑器是Linux操作系统中的重要工具。其中,VIM是使用最广泛的文本编辑器,VIM的全称是“Visual interface IMproved”,即“改良的视觉交互界面”。使用VIM编辑器能够在任何shell、字符终端或基于字符的网络连接...
vim是全屏幕文本编辑器,没有菜单,只有命令。 1.1启动与退出vim 在系统提示符后输入vim 和想要编辑(或建立)的文件名,便可进入vim,如: [root@RHEL7-1 ~]# vim myfile 如果只输入vim,而不带文件名,也...
10.2.1 上下文相关菜单 10.2.2 选择软件包 10.2.3 查看可用软件包 10.3 配置 10.4 操纵软件包 10.4.1 查询软件包 10.4.2 校验软件包 10.4.3 安装新的软件包 10.4.3.1 升级软件包 10.4.4 卸载软件包 11 ...